Aimed at scholars, professionals, and researchers, the book examines the gender-specific issues relating to \u003cstrong\u003elegal frameworks\u003c\/strong\u003e and \u003cstrong\u003ehealth policies\u003c\/strong\u003e, covering global perspectives on these matters. It reflects on the United Nations' efforts to eliminate gender discrimination and promote gender equality, with particular attention to legal rights, health strategies, and empowerment programs that have been adopted worldwide. The book takes a \u003cstrong\u003ehuman rights perspective\u003c\/strong\u003e, emphasizing the role of law in safeguarding women's rights in India and other parts of the world.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e book is divided into two key themes: \u003cstrong\u003egender and law\u003c\/strong\u003e and \u003cstrong\u003egender and health\u003c\/strong\u003e, providing case studies, research papers, and theoretical insights. Topics like \u003cstrong\u003efemale foeticide\u003c\/strong\u003e, \u003cstrong\u003ematernity benefits\u003c\/strong\u003e, and \u003cstrong\u003egender dynamics in health\u003c\/strong\u003e are addressed in depth.
